Morphological Study on Direct Nitridation of Titanium Pellet

Abstract

Dissections of solid samples partially reacted under different conditions were examined to determine the control region of the reaction between titanium pellet and nitrogen gas. The thickness of the pellet studied was varied from 0.0012 to 0.00638 m while temperature was varied from 1, 173 to 1, 473 K. Experimental results indicate that the system is in the chemical reaction control region as the pellet thickness is 0.0012 m for all temperatures studied. The system is in the gas-pore-diffusion control region when the thickness is 0.00638 m and the temperature is 1, 373 or 1, 473 K. For other cases, the system is in both control region.
